P1078, P1084 EVT CONTROL POSITION SENSOR
P1078, P1084 EVT CONTROL POSITION SENSOR
Description
INFOID:0000000003133499
Exhaust valve timing control position sensor detects the concave
groove of the exhaust camshaft rear end.
This sensor signal is used for sensing a position of the exhaust cam-
shaft.
This sensor uses a Hall IC.
Based on the position of the exhaust camshaft, ECM controls
exhaust valve timing control magnet retarder to optimize the shut/
open timing of exhaust valve for the driving condition.
